永发信息网

javascript简单翻译

答案:2  悬赏:0  手机版
解决时间 2021-03-05 20:10
  • 提问者网友:临风不自傲
  • 2021-03-05 16:39
&lt;script language=&quot;javascript&quot;&gt;<br>function name(canshu)<br>{<br>var id=canshu.id<br>alert(&quot;你点击的是&quot;+id)<br>}<br>&lt;/script&gt;<br>&lt;body&gt;<br>&lt;table&gt;<br>&lt;tr&gt;<br>&lt;td id=&quot;1&quot; onclick=&quot;name(this)&quot;&gt;第一个&lt;/td&gt;<br>&lt;td id=&quot;2&quot; onclick=&quot;name(this)&quot;&gt;第二个&lt;/td&gt;<br>&lt;/tr&gt;<br>&lt;/table&gt;<br>onclick=&quot;name(this)&quot; 这个this是表示传递他的ID呢 还是按钮就是他本身的意思?
最佳答案
  • 五星知识达人网友:思契十里
  • 2021-03-05 18:03
1.<td id="1" onclick="name(this)">第一个</td>
td标签,有id属性 onclick事件
this代表拥有这个事件的对象
所以这里是表示TD
2.注意:this只能在传参的时候当参数用。在script里的代码里是不可以写this的。
全部回答
  • 1楼网友:纵马山川剑自提
  • 2021-03-05 19:22
javascript的:这件事情在字面表达前缀 __dopostback的(&apos;lb011&apos;,&apos;&apos;),用于这是一个呼叫 功能的文字表达式,是你在url中地址栏,或直接写在标签的js这样的方式 财产背后的<a href =“ www.baidu.com 的“的onclick =”javascript的:警报(&apos;abc&apos;)“>测试
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息
大家都在看
推荐资讯